Transaction 9e14deb85c2f38bb40b4b258065721068190e563c3b0dc631d081840fa2c7e51

1 Input
2 Outputs
  • 9e14deb85c2f38bb40b4b258065721068190e563c3b0dc631d081840fa2c7e51:0
  • value  3912861849
    address  2MttWsVWL3WTe3GfrF8UVUQztY2jeStNGhB
  • 9e14deb85c2f38bb40b4b258065721068190e563c3b0dc631d081840fa2c7e51:1
  • value  1176845
    address  2Mud95MVEfQHRDNVWzrmfZppUMhkJ5jhvz7